Epsom and Ewell High School

Epsom and Ewell High School is a non-selective state funded secondary school for boys and girls. 9% of grades in GCSE Maths and English Language were 7-9 (A or A*). The average house price within a 1km radius of the school is £486,767. Over a 12 month period, 1002 crimes were recorded within the same radius.
